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
60331086438 3000988057 277564384
54000668 913 59586076
54000668 913 59586076
62822 09 576267 929831625
All about undefined
Interested in learning more?
54000668 913 59586076
62822 09 576267 929831625
See more
6895633 76861858066 76325690
04363880 0138 6565123286
See more
81672123982 6016975327 817
9108163 99097 87
See more